Yeap,I remember the ole Mitchells and Diawas... Used to fish piers a lot for kings back then.. Saw more than a couple of those reels do a "meltdown" and lock up on a big king.. :D
I was using squider at first then abu's.. I can remember driving all of Pea Island. Can remember all the drum blitzes that used to occur on s side of Oregon Inlet every spring.. Can remember fishing Buxton Point and being one of maybe three or four conventionals fishing.. Can remember the big bluefish blitzes that were close to insane back then as well.. Stripers were pretty much nonexistant when you were there 25yrs ago,but we have had some good yrs since.. Last yr and this yr were slow,but at least there are some around nowadays.. Cobia fishing has been phenominal since the days you were last here..
It was special back then with no "super mini motels" all over,but it is also special now.. By Hateras being made up of mostly national park,these high dollar developements can't go but so far..Hopefully with the help of OBPA and other groups we can conserve this paradise for future generations to access and enjoy..
